Reservation - for hotels, motels and guest houses The reservation module of swift.ng cloud ERP is created specifically for hotels and guest houses. It enables you manage all departments of your hotel seamlessly. It is made up of 2 components; on-site and off-site reservation. more... |
Reservation - Current Guests This page allows one to view current guests which include guests who booked beforehand and those who have checked in. It displays details which include the guest room number, type of room, guest name and the duration of the guest stay. more... |
Reservation - Checking-out This page simply shows a list of current guest(s) that are to check-out on current day. more... |
Reservation - Date Search This page offers a simple feature that allows one to search for the status and details on rooms within a predetermined period of time. more... |
Reservation - Setup Rooms This sub-module is used to create different room categories based on the features and cost of these reservations for the guests. more... |
Reservation - Setup Discounts This page functions simply to setup discounts for room in the establishment. You simply click on 'Create New' and add a description and amount for the discount and click on Create more... |
Reservation - Guest Payments Clicking this links to a page with a ‘date’ search bar on top where one can generate a guest payment invoice based on the time period specified. The Details of the invoice include date, entered by, guest name, arrival, departure and amount. more... |
Reservation - Guest List Clicking this links to a page with a ‘date’ search bar on top where one can generate details of all guests that reserved a room in the establishment within a period of time. The details include Guest’s Name, Ref. Number, Phone Number, Arrival and Departure time e.t.c. more... |
Reservation - Settings The Reservation settings is used to enable VAT and/or Service Charge, setup guest bill options, make a header, introductory text, footer and reservation policy for the establishment. more... |
